History and Overview
The Goethe Certificate is named after Johann Wolfgang von Goethe, a renowned German author, thinker, and statesman. The certificate is released by the Goethe-Institut, a non-profit organization that promotes German language and culture worldwide. Founded in 1951, the Goethe-Institut has actually developed an extensive language efficiency structure that assesses language skills in reading, writing, listening, and speaking.
Structure and Levels
The Goethe Certificate is divided into 6 levels, lining up with the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). Each level represents an unique stage of language efficiency, from novice (a1 zertifikat kaufen erfahrungen) to advanced (C2). The levels are:
- A1: Beginner - Basic knowledge of German, capability to interact in everyday scenarios.
- A2: Elementary - Understanding of fundamental phrases, vocabulary, and grammar.
- B1: Intermediate - Ability to interact successfully in daily scenarios, both in composing and speaking.
- B2: Upper-Intermediate - Understanding of complex texts, conversations, and discussions.
- C1: Advanced - High level of language proficiency, capability to communicate with complete confidence and properly.

Exam Format and Content

The Goethe Certificate exam consists of 4 sections: reading, composing, listening, and speaking. The exam format and content differ depending on the level, but normally include:
- Reading: Comprehension of texts, such as posts, news, and literary excerpts.
- Composing: Writing tasks, such as essays, emails, and narratives.
- Listening: Audio recordings, such as discussions, lectures, and news broadcasts.
- Speaking: Face-to-face conversation with an examiner, examining pronunciation, vocabulary, and communication skills.
